Reading boss Coppell: No Lita offers

Reading boss Steve Coppell says he has received no enquiries for Leroy Lita since the striker made it clear he wanted to quit the Royals.

England Under-21 international Lita has had enough of being left on the bench in recent months and is keen to move in the transfer window.

But Coppell, who will give the former Bristol City man a rare start in Tuesday's FA Cup replay at home to Tottenham, is in no mood to grant him that wish.

He said: "He is a player that wants to play, that's the bottom line and has been for months.

"He is a player under contract but the way of the world is such that if there is an opening for somebody somewhere then I'm sure we will hear about it.

"But I have not heard from anybody about Leroy. There has been a lot of speculation but I have certainly heard nothing.

"It is a non-issue because no-one has come in for him. It is the 14th of January and nobody has phoned about him - 100%."
